How they compare
Vietnam currently reports 23.53 million tonnes against 13.93 million tonnes in Malaysia, a difference of 9.61 million tonnes.
That makes Vietnam's figure about 1.7 times Malaysia's.
The two have swapped places 60 times across 130 shared years of data; in 1893 it was Vietnam ahead.
Malaysia ranks 9th and Vietnam ranks 6th of 215 countries.
Across the 14 decades both report, Malaysia averaged higher in 5 and Vietnam in 9.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Malaysia | Vietnam |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1890s | 10,469 tonnes | 74,327 tonnes | 63,858 tonnes | Vietnam |
| 1900s | 4,763 tonnes | 28,579 tonnes | 23,816 tonnes | Vietnam |
| 1910s | 102,134 tonnes | 116,332 tonnes | 14,198 tonnes | Vietnam |
| 1920s | 334,523 tonnes | 355,700 tonnes | 21,177 tonnes | Vietnam |
| 1930s | -241,091 tonnes | 176,920 tonnes | 418,012 tonnes | Vietnam |
| 1940s | -48,364 tonnes | -601,566 tonnes | 553,202 tonnes | Malaysia |
| 1950s | 196,314 tonnes | 552,806 tonnes | 356,492 tonnes | Vietnam |
| 1960s | 595,451 tonnes | 2.05 million tonnes | 1.45 million tonnes | Vietnam |
| 1970s | 1.82 million tonnes | -1.08 million tonnes | 2.90 million tonnes | Malaysia |
| 1980s | 2.28 million tonnes | 114,820 tonnes | 2.16 million tonnes | Malaysia |
| 1990s | 5.39 million tonnes | 3.12 million tonnes | 2.28 million tonnes | Malaysia |
| 2000s | 8.81 million tonnes | 7.59 million tonnes | 1.22 million tonnes | Malaysia |
| 2010s | 8.56 million tonnes | 21.48 million tonnes | 12.93 million tonnes | Vietnam |
| 2020s | 2.51 million tonnes | 6.32 million tonnes | 3.81 million tonnes | Vietnam |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
